How to Ask for Price Politely

In any business transaction, knowing how to ask for the price of a product or service politely is crucial. It can make a significant difference in how the transaction unfolds and can even impact the relationship between the buyer and the seller. Whether you’re shopping in a physical store or browsing online, here are some tips on how to ask for the price politely.

1. Start with a greeting

Always begin with a polite greeting. This sets a positive tone for the conversation. For example, you can say, “Good morning, may I ask the price of this item?” or “Hello, I’m interested in this product, could you tell me how much it costs?”

2. Be specific about what you’re asking for

Instead of asking a general question like “How much does this cost?” which can be overwhelming, be specific about the item you’re interested in. For instance, “I’m looking at the silver necklace in the display case, could you please tell me the price?”

3. Show genuine interest

Expressing genuine interest in the product can make the seller more willing to provide the information you need. You can say, “I’m really interested in this item and would like to know the price so I can consider purchasing it.”

4. Use polite language

Avoid using aggressive or confrontational language when asking for the price. Instead, use polite words like “please,” “thank you,” and “could you.” For example, “Could you please tell me the price of this item?” or “Thank you for your assistance.”

5. Be prepared for different responses

Be mentally prepared for various responses from the seller. They might provide the price immediately, or they might ask you a few questions to understand your needs better. Be patient and responsive to their questions.

6. Offer a reason for your inquiry

Sometimes, offering a reason for your inquiry can make the seller more willing to provide the information. For example, “I’m planning to make a purchase today, and I’d like to know the price to ensure it fits within my budget.”

7. Be respectful of the seller’s time

Remember that the seller is also working, and their time is valuable. Be respectful of their time by asking your questions politely and concisely.

In conclusion, asking for the price politely is essential in any business transaction. By following these tips, you can ensure a smooth and pleasant interaction with the seller, which can lead to a successful purchase and a positive relationship.
